My last experiment with intention-manifestation was a smashing success, and I’d like to try another community experiment if anyone’s interested in playing along. This round of the experiment will run from August 1 to August 31. (Any interest in doing a longer time frame next time around, maybe September 1 to December 31?)

Here’s a refresher on how to participate:

  • Find a place to be alone. (You’ll need a pencil and a piece of paper.)
  • Close your eyes, take a few deep breaths, and relax.
  • Look inward and ask yourself you’d like to achieve/manifest by August 31.
  • Open your eyes and start writing ideas as they come to you.
  • Once you have a few possibilities, select the one that you feel most passionately about. It also needs to be something you can truly believe in.
  • Write a specific goal statement, which ends with “Make it so!”
  • Read your statement out loud with as much feeling and conviction as possible. Feel that mental “click” as you DECIDE to achieve your goal.
  • Leave a comment or send me an email to let me know that you’re participating (you don’t have to disclose your goal).
  • Be on the watch throughout the month of August for the manifestation of your goal. It may not appear in the form you’re expecting…
  • Report back and let us know how you did!

My goal is to receive $500 from sources other than my salaried income by August 31, 2008. Make it so!

I wanted to try a money goal not because I need $500, but because needing money in order to feel “secure” is something that holds me back from pursuing writing full-time. It’s hard for me to contemplate leaving a regular paycheck for the uncharted (and potentially unpaid) waters of the writing profession. Knowing that I can “manifest” money would be a huge confidence boost when it comes to taking the plunge and quitting the old day job!
